Title: Beyond “bad apples”: The nature and extent of sexual misconduct in medicineWithin the last decade, there have been myriad research and policy developments in relation to sexual misconduct in medicine. From the operating room to the psychiatric clinical setting, both patients and medical professionals report experiences of sexual harassment and misconduct. In this poster, we will present preliminary findings from our review of the extant literature on sexual misconduct perpetrated by medical professionals. Focusing on the UK context, we map out the nature and extent of the problem. In so doing, we draw attention to the various factors that contribute to higher rates of sexual misconduct in health contexts. Rather than being perpetrated by a few “bad apples”, this poster instead demonstrates that sexual misconduct is a pervasive problem amongst medical professionals. The continued failure to identify and prevent sexual misconduct reveals wider problems within the culture of medicine itself, and provides new insights into the power dynamics that give rise to the particular case of sexual misconduct in medical contexts.
